Houston Texans Defense -
Total yards per game: 268.4 (1st in the league) Total points per game: 16.3 (2nd in the league) Rushing yards per game: 92.5 (4th in the league) Passing yards per game: 175.8 (2nd in the league) Atlanta Falcons Offense - Total yards per game: 365.9 (13th in the league) Total points per game: 23.5 (12th in the league) Rushing yards per game: 117.7 (14th in the league) Passing yards per game: 248.2 (11th in the league) This game is about the defense. We have a shot on paper. To win this game, the Texans have to hold the Falcons closer to the Texans defensive stats than Atlanta's offensive stats. Most importantly, less than 20 points. Texans' Offense - Total yards per game: 379.7 (8th in the league) Total points per game: 26.6 (5th in the league) Rushing yards per game: 151.7 (3rd in the league) Passing yards per game: 228 (16th in the league) Atlanta's Defense - Total yards per game: 329.9 (9th in the league) Total points per game: 20.6 (14th in the league) Rushing yards per game: 83.5 (2nd in the league) Passing yards per game: 245.7 (23rd in the league) Again, favoring the Houston Texans. If today's results are closer to our average output, we win the game. But they don't play the game on paper.... you know that. I know that... It's going to be an interesting game. We get to test our defense against Atlanta, our first "real" test in the last 5 games. & we get to see what Kubiak's system can do against a top ten defense our second in 5 games.
